What Is Aluminum 2024 Machining?
Aluminum 2024 machining refers to the process of cutting, milling, turning, drilling, or shaping 2024 aluminum alloy into precise components. This alloy mainly contains aluminum and copper, with small amounts of magnesium and manganese to improve strength and hardness.
Compared with general-purpose aluminum alloys, 2024 aluminum offers higher mechanical strength. It is often used for parts that require structural reliability, such as aircraft components, high-performance automotive parts, gears, shafts, and industrial equipment.

Key Features of Aluminum Machining 2024
1. Excellent Strength-to-Weight Ratio
One of the biggest advantages of aluminum 2024 is its impressive strength while maintaining a lightweight structure. This makes it especially valuable in industries where reducing weight can improve efficiency and performance.
For example, aerospace manufacturers often choose aluminum 2024 because every kilogram saved can contribute to better fuel efficiency and improved overall design flexibility.
2. Good Fatigue Resistance
Mechanical parts that experience repeated stress require materials that can maintain performance over time. Aluminum 2024 has strong fatigue resistance, allowing machined components to handle continuous loading conditions.
This feature makes it suitable for aircraft structures, transportation equipment, and high-performance machinery.
3. Precision Machining Capability
Although aluminum 2024 is stronger than many common aluminum alloys, it can still be machined effectively using CNC technology. Modern CNC milling machines, turning centers, and advanced cutting tools allow manufacturers to produce complex shapes with high accuracy.
A professional machining supplier can create components with smooth surfaces, accurate dimensions, and consistent quality. Proper cooling methods and tool selection are important because excessive heat can affect machining efficiency.

Aluminum Machining 2024 Performance Review
After evaluating the advantages and disadvantages of aluminum 2024 machining, I believe this material is best suited for applications where strength matters more than extreme corrosion resistance.
In terms of machining quality, aluminum 2024 can achieve excellent results when processed by experienced CNC manufacturers. The surface finish is generally smooth, and dimensional accuracy can meet strict engineering requirements.
However, it is worth noting that aluminum 2024 has lower corrosion resistance compared with alloys such as aluminum 6061. In environments exposed to moisture or chemicals, additional surface treatments like anodizing or protective coatings may be necessary.
Another consideration is cost. Aluminum 2024 is usually more expensive than standard aluminum grades because of its higher performance characteristics. For simple applications where maximum strength is not required, a lower-cost alloy may be more economical.
